Some best practices for the transport of hazardous substances on-site are: Always use secondary containment by placing bottle, jars, or other chemical containers in a tray or other carrier when moving chemicals on-site. Don’t carry trays containing hazardous chemicals by hand—use appropriate equipment, such as laboratory carts.

The rotary kiln is made up of steel tubes having the diameter of 2.5-3.0 meter and the length differs from 90-120meter. The inner side of the kiln is lined with refractory bricks. The kiln is supported on the columns of masonry or concrete and rested on roller bearing in slightly inclined position at the gradient of 1 in 25 to 1 in 30.
When you are in the laboratory and take a direct sniff of the chemicals you are using, you run the risk of damaging your mucous meranes or your lungs. When it is necessary to smell chemicals in the lab, the proper technique is to cup your hand above the container and waft the air toward your face. Try not to breathe in the air through your

The Science Behind Glow Sticks. Glow sticks contain two sets of chemicals that when coined, create a chemical reaction called Chemiluminescence. In the outer part of the glow stick, a coination of phenyl oxalate ester and fluorescent dye are used. Inside the glass tube, a coination of hydrogen peroxide and a phthalate ester solvent are mixed.

Preparation of compound using iron filings and sulphur powder: Take about 14g of fine iron fillings and 8g sulphur powder in a china dish. Mix them well and heat the contents of the china dish, first gently, then strongly.

Pipetting whole blood. Use forward technique steps 1 and 2 to fill the tip with blood (do not pre-rinse the tip). Wipe the tip carefully with a dry clean cloth. Dip the tip into the blood and press the operating button to the first stop. Make sure the tip is sufficiently below the surface.
